H4 EAD Processing Time. Processing times for H4 EAD can vary, but are typically around 3-6 months as of 2023. The only time an employer may accept a receipt for a pending EAD would be if the receipt is for a replacement of a lost, stolen or damaged document—not simply an initial document or a renewal ...Now that the long-awaited H-4 EAD rule has been finalized, with an effective date of May 26, 2015, many of the lingering questions regarding eligibility and the application process have been answered. ... First of the required documents for H4 visa EAD application is evidence of your current H4 visa status. You can show evidence of H4 status by providing one of the following: Copy of your most recent Form I-797, Notice of Action, for Form I-539, Application to Extend/Change Nonimmigrant Status; or. Copy of Form I-94, Arrival/Departure Record.The DHS projects an H4 EAD processing time of between two to six months, though it usually goes through faster. Following the H4 EAD status tracking, you will find that it usually ranges between a month and a half to two months for EAD application status to go from 'Application Received' to 'New Card Being Processed.' H-4 spouses are entitled to an EAD valid for up to 3 years, which is the maximum increment of time for which H-4 status can be granted at a time. No. An H4 visa EAD is not an entry document. A valid passport and H4 nonimmigrant visa (unless you are visa exempt) or other travel document must be used to return to the US.
